Overview

The Commonlands MCP server connects your AI assistant directly to Commonlands lens data, optics calculators, and live product details. This way your assistant can correctly calculate field of view with distortion instead of guessing, incorrectly interpolating, or writing it's own script. Built for machine vision, embedded vision, robotics, and industrial imaging, the server exposes 22 tools for M12 lens (S-mount lens) and C-mount lens selection. Your assistant can search the lens catalog, match lenses to specific image sensors by active area and image circle, run Commonlands field of view (FOV) calculations, estimate effective focal length (EFL) and pixels per degree, find distortion, and compare candidate part numbers. Ask it the way you would ask an applications engineer: Find M12 lenses for a 1/2.8" sensor at ~80 degrees horizontal field of view, then verify with the Commonlands field of view calculator. Compare two part numbers for a robotics camera: M12 mount fit, C-mount alternatives, FOV, and low-distortion options. Recommend low-distortion machine vision lenses for a 1/1.8" sensor. Every answer is source-labeled: fixture catalog, Commonlands calculator, live product read, cart handoff, or engineering review. Before showing any product URL, price, inventory signal, or variant, the assistant reads live Shopify product data, so specs stay accurate. Commerce is safe by design. Cart tools create, read, and update a cart only after you confirm exact line items and quantities, then return a continue URL for human review and payment. Checkout and order creation are intentionally disabled: the assistant cannot pay, place an order, or bypass storefront review. Connect in seconds, no OAuth or API key required: URL: https://mcp.commonlands.com/mcp Works with Claude (web, desktop, mobile), Claude Code, Cursor, Continue, Zed, and any MCP client. calculate_field_of_view

Claude
Calculate Commonlands lens field of view for a lens/sensor pair and return HFOV, VFOV, DFOV, coverage, distortion status, and an explicit rectilinear comparison. Use this tool for FOV, HFOV, VFOV, DFOV, field of view, "lens for", lens-to-sensor, AR0234, IMX290, IMX477, and sensor part-number requests. It returns Commonlands data the model cannot derive: live backend FoV when configured, distortion model/status, image-circle coverage, live stock through Shopify read tools where applicable, and MTF/CRA/BFL fields if present in upstream catalog data. Do not use naive rectilinear fallback, focal-length-only math, interpolation, or self-computed catalog estimates when a Commonlands lens/sensor route is available. Accepts lens_sku/lensSku or focal_length_mm/focalLengthMm, plus sensor/sensorPartNumber/sensor_part_number and working_distance_mm/workingDistanceMm. If only focal length is supplied, the response is marked as a rectilinear reference and does not claim Commonlands distortion-corrected lens truth.

submit_rfq

Claude
Forward a buyer request-for-quote or engineering question to the Commonlands engineering team. Two-step, buyer-confirmed: the first call returns a preview and sends nothing; show the buyer the preview (including their reply-to email) and, only after they explicitly approve, call again with confirm: true to send. The recipient is fixed to the Commonlands inbox (the agent cannot choose it); this only sends an inquiry and never creates an order, charges a card, or writes Shopify/customer data. Include part numbers, sensor, quantity, and application when known so the team can reply with a quote. Commonlands replies by email.

update_cart

Claude
Update a Shopify-owned cart through the configured Cart/Storefront MCP endpoint. Owner-bound: requires the cart_access_token returned by create_cart, so only the session that created a cart can change it. With UCP endpoints, treat updates as full-state PUT semantics; with the confirmed standard Storefront MCP endpoint, Commonlands maps line_items to Shopify add_items, update_items to quantity changes, and remove_line_ids to explicit removals. Quantity 0 in update_items removes a line.
